Pantone’s “Ultimate Gray” and “Illuminating Yellow” were announced as the Colors of the Year for 2021, which perfectly encapsulate the message of aspiration and hope – something we surely need after everything that has happened in 2020. As expected, we’ll be seeing a lot more of these complimentary colors in fashion, interior, and marketing trends.
To inspire you to incorporate them into your everyday life, we’ve compiled a list of ideas that will brighten up your space or help build your wardrobe.
